Self-rated health and chronic inflammation are related and independently associated with hospitalization and long-term mortality in the general population

Abstract The subjective indicator of health self-rated health (SRH) and the chronic inflammation biomarker soluble urokinase plasminogen activator receptor (suPAR) are both robust predictors of healthcare use and mortality.
